As a Product Designer, you will craft elegant, customer-focused web applications (desktop and mobile) for millions of Docusign users around the globe. They will be end-to-end designs of new features across Docusign's Intelligent Agreement Management platform that uses artificial intelligence to bring agreement management into the 21st century. These features will empower customers to break out of the "Agreement Trap" by transforming agreement data into insights and actions, accelerate contract review cycles, and boost productivity organization-wide. This position is an individual contributor role reporting to Lead Product Designer.

  • Champion design, pushing yourself to explore big ideas before narrowing in on feasible, inventive solutions that sweat the small details
  • Partner with product management, engineering, user research and tech writers to define multiple features that impact the whole product, ultimately helping to define product direction, with guidance from more senior designers
  • Own full-stack design execution including UI, architecture, interaction and visual design, and measure ongoing improvements
  • Produce deliverables for every stage of the design process - storyboards, wireframes, user flows, interactive prototypes, and pixel-perfect visual assets for web and mobile
  • Utilize and contribute new patterns to Docusign's design system to maintain scalable design across our product ecosystem
  • Leverage all data points like analytics and research to inform your work but rely on your intuition to fill in the gaps
  • Contribute to a creative, supportive culture for the entire Product Experience team
